26 Erros iguais
#10

Menu Inteiro :
Код:
if(dialogid == 10) // Agencia
    {
        if(response)
        {
            new string[256];            
            new nomepl[MAX_PLAYER_NAME];
            GetPlayerName(playerid, nomepl, sizeof(nomepl));
               if(listitem == 0) // Estбgiario 
            {
            SendClientMessage(playerid, Verde, "Vocк agora й um estбgiario !");
            dini_IntSet(nomepl, "Profissao", 1)
            SpawnPlayer(playerid);    
            }
            if(listitem == 1) // Guarda 
            {
            if(dini_Int(nomepl, "Experiencia") > 6 && dini_Int(nomepl, "Faculdade") > 2){ 
            SendClientMessage(playerid, Verde, "Vocк agora й um Guarda !");
            dini_IntSet(nomepl, "Profissao", 2)
            SpawnPlayer(playerid);
            } else {
            format(string, sizeof(string), "Requer: %d/7 Meses de Experiencia de trabalho, %d/3 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}
            if(listitem == 2) // Policial Rodoviбrio 
            {
            if(dini_Int(nomepl, "Experiencia") > 16 && dini_Int(nomepl, "Faculdade") > 7){ 
            SendClientMessage(playerid, Verde, "Vocк agora й um Policial rodoviбrio !");
          dini_IntSet(nomepl, "Profissao", 3)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/17 Meses de Experiencia de trabalho, %d/8 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}
           if(listitem == 3) // Policial Militar 
                  {
                if(dini_Int(nomepl, "Experiencia") > 24 && dini_Int(nomepl, "Faculdade") > 13 && dini_Int(nomepl, "HabTerrestre")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й um Policial Militar !");
            dini_IntSet(nomepl, "Profissao", 4)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/25 Meses de Experiencia de trabalho, %d/14 Meses na faculdade %d/1 Habilitaзгo terrestre.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"), dini_Int(nomepl, "HabTerrestre"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}
            if(listitem == 4) // Policial Civil 
            {
            if(dini_Int(nomepl, "Experiencia") > 29 && dini_Int(nomepl, "Faculdade") > 15 && dini_Int(nomepl, "HabTerrestre")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й um Policial Civil !");
            dini_IntSet(nomepl, "Profissao", 5)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/30 Meses de Experiencia de trabalho, %d/16 Meses na faculdade %d/1 Habilitaзгo terrestre.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"), dini_Int(nomepl, "HabTerrestre"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}            
            if(listitem == 5) // Policial Federal 
            {
            if(dini_Int(nomepl, "Experiencia") > 40 && dini_Int(nomepl, "Faculdade") > 20 && dini_Int(nomepl, "HabTerrestre") == 1 && dini_Int(nomepl, "HabAerea")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й um Policial Federal !");
            dini_IntSet(nomepl, "Profissao", 6)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/41 Meses de Experiencia de trabalho, %d/21 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Habilitaзгo terrestre %d/1 Habilitaзгo Aerea %d/1.", dini_Int(nomepl, "HabTerrestre"), dini_Int(nomepl, "HabAerea"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}
            if(listitem == 6) // Delegado 
            {
            if(dini_Int(nomepl, "Experiencia") > 36 && dini_Int(nomepl, "Faculdade") > 18 && dini_Int(nomepl, "HabTerrestre") == 1 && dini_Int(nomepl, "HabAerea")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й um Delegado !");
            dini_IntSet(nomepl, "Profissao", 7)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/37 Meses de Experiencia de trabalho, %d/19 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Habilitaзгo terrestre %d/1 Habilitaзгo Aerea %d/1.", dini_Int(nomepl, "HabTerrestre"), dini_Int(nomepl, "HabAerea"));            
            SendClientMessage(playerid, Vermelho, string);
            }             
            }
            if(listitem == 7) // Bope 
            {
            if(dini_Int(nomepl, "Experiencia") > 44 && dini_Int(nomepl, "Faculdade") > 26 && dini_Int(nomepl, "HabTerrestre") == 1 && dini_Int(nomepl, "HabAerea") == 1 && dini_Int(nomepl, "HabNautica")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й do BOPE !");
            dini_IntSet(nomepl, "Profissao", 8)
            SpawnPlayer(playerid);            
            } else {            
            format(string, sizeof(string), "Requer: %d/45 Meses de Experiencia de trabalho, %d/27 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Habilitaзгo terrestre %d/1 Habilitaзгo Aerea %d/1 Habilitaзгo Nautica %d/1.", dini_Int(nomepl, "HabTerrestre"), dini_Int(nomepl, "HabAerea"), dini_Int(nomepl, "HabNautica"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}
            if(listitem == 8) // Swat 
            {
            if(dini_Int(nomepl, "Experiencia") > 54 && dini_Int(nomepl, "Faculdade") > 29 && dini_Int(nomepl, "HabTerrestre") == 1 && dini_Int(nomepl, "HabAerea") == 1 && dini_Int(nomepl, "HabNautica")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й da SWAT !");
            dini_IntSet(nomepl, "Profissao", 9)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/55 Meses de Experiencia de trabalho, %d/30 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Habilitaзгo terrestre %d/1 Habilitaзгo Aerea %d/1 Habilitaзгo Nautica %d/1.", dini_Int(nomepl, "HabTerrestre"), dini_Int(nomepl, "HabAerea"), dini_Int(nomepl, "HabNautica"));            
            SendClientMessage(playerid, Vermelho, string);
            }            
            }
            if(listitem == 9) // Narcoticos 
            {
            if(dini_Int(nomepl, "Experiencia") > 52 && dini_Int(nomepl, "Faculdade") > 32 && dini_Int(nomepl, "HabTerrestre") == 1 && dini_Int(nomepl, "HabAerea") == 1 && dini_Int(nomepl, "HabNautica")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й da Narcoticos !");
            dini_IntSet(nomepl, "Profissao", 10)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/53 Meses de Experiencia de trabalho, %d/33 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Habilitaзгo terrestre %d/1 Habilitaзгo Aerea %d/1 Habilitaзгo Nautica %d/1.", dini_Int(nomepl, "HabTerrestre"), dini_Int(nomepl, "HabAerea"), dini_Int(nomepl, "HabNautica"));            
            SendClientMessage(playerid, Vermelho, string);                          
             }
             }             
             if(listitem == 10) // Traficante de armas
            {
            if(dini_Int(nomepl, "Experiencia") > 4 && dini_Int(nomepl, "Celular")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й Traficante de Armas !");
            dini_IntSet(nomepl, "Profissao", 11)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/5 Meses de Experiencia de trabalho %d/0 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Celular %d/1.", dini_Int(nomepl, "Celular"));            
            SendClientMessage(playerid, Vermelho, string);                          
             }
             }             
             if(listitem == 11) // Assasino
            {
            if(dini_Int(nomepl, "Experiencia") > 8 && dini_Int(nomepl, "Celular")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й Assasino !");
            dini_IntSet(nomepl, "Profissao", 12)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/9 Meses de Experiencia de trabalho %d/0 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Celular %d/1.", dini_Int(nomepl, "Celular"));            
            SendClientMessage(playerid, Vermelho, string);                          
             }
             }             
             if(listitem == 12) // Terrorista
            {
            if(dini_Int(nomepl, "Experiencia") > 25 && dini_Int(nomepl, "Celular")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й Terrorista!");
            dini_IntSet(nomepl, "Profissao", 13)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/26 Meses de Experiencia de trabalho %d/0 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Celular %d/1.", dini_Int(nomepl, "Celular"));            
            SendClientMessage(playerid, Vermelho, string);                          
             }
             }             
             if(listitem == 13) // Sequestrador
            {
            if(dini_Int(nomepl, "Experiencia") > 31 && dini_Int(nomepl, "Celular")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й Terrorista!");
            dini_IntSet(nomepl, "Profissao", 14)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/32 Meses de Experiencia de trabalho %d/0 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Celular %d/1.", dini_Int(nomepl, "Celular"));            
            SendClientMessage(playerid, Vermelho, string);                          
             }
             }             
             if(listitem == 14) // Assasino profissional
            {
            if(dini_Int(nomepl, "Experiencia") > 33 && dini_Int(nomepl, "Celular") == 1){ 
            SendClientMessage(playerid, Verde, "Vocк agora й Terrorista!");
            dini_IntSet(nomepl, "Profissao", 15)
            SpawnPlayer(playerid);
            } else {            
            format(string, sizeof(string), "Requer: %d/34 Meses de Experiencia de trabalho %d/0 Meses na faculdade.", dini_Int(nomepl, "Experiencia"), dini_Int(nomepl, "Faculdade"));            
            SendClientMessage(playerid, Vermelho, string);            
            format(string, sizeof(string), "Celular %d/1.", dini_Int(nomepl, "Celular"));            
            SendClientMessage(playerid, Vermelho, string);                          
             }
             }
Reply


Messages In This Thread
26 Erros iguais - by oakley - 11.09.2010, 01:53
Re: 26 Erros iguais - by [Ips]Guh - 11.09.2010, 01:57
Re: 26 Erros iguais - by oakley - 11.09.2010, 02:00
Re: 26 Erros iguais - by [Ips]Guh - 11.09.2010, 02:02
Re: 26 Erros iguais - by Rodolfo_Halls - 11.09.2010, 02:02
Re: 26 Erros iguais - by oakley - 11.09.2010, 02:03
Re: 26 Erros iguais - by [Ips]Guh - 11.09.2010, 02:07
Re: 26 Erros iguais - by oakley - 11.09.2010, 02:18
Re: 26 Erros iguais - by andmeida10 - 11.09.2010, 11:29
Re: 26 Erros iguais - by oakley - 11.09.2010, 13:31

Forum Jump:


Users browsing this thread: 1 Guest(s)